Do all puppies come out in a sac?

Each puppy is enclosed in a sac that is part of the placenta or afterbirth. This sac is usually broken during the birthing process and passes through the vulva after each puppy is born. Sometimes a mother will have two or three puppies and then pass several of the afterbirths together.

Do puppies have their own amniotic sac?

When there are multiple pups in the womb, each puppy has their own amniotic sac, which all contain their own placenta. Usually when a puppy is passing through the birth canal, the sac will break. For it to stay intact during birth is uncommon, but not unheard of.

How do I get my puppy out of the sac?

Carefully hook one finger into the placenta or sac and gently tear it away from the puppy’s head. Gently pull the sac off the puppy. Suction fluids from the puppy’s nose and mouth. Rub the puppy with a towel to stimulate breathing.

How long after water sac do puppies come?

The amniotic sac passes into the cervix and anterior pelvis, resulting in abdominal straining and panting. Next, the perineum (skin around the vulva) distends as the amnion and pup is delivered. The first fetus should be delivered within 2 to 3 hours after the beginning of the start of hard labor.

What do you do when a newborn puppy is having trouble breathing?

Lower the puppy’s head to help drain fluid from his lungs, mouth and throat. Place a suction bulb inside the puppy’s mouth and nose to get rid of extra fluid. When the airway is clear, cover the puppy’s mouth and nose with your mouth, then breathe slightly two to three times.
